    Plastic Intalox Saddle Ring Product Description

     
    Plastic Intalox Saddle Ring is a high-efficiency random tower packing that blends ring and saddle structural designs, leveraging the strengths of both configurations to boost industrial tower performance.
     
    It delivers key advantages including high free volume, low pressure drop, reduced mass-transfer unit height, and an elevated flooding point—along with uniform gas-liquid contact and high mass transfer efficiency, making it ideal for intensive separation and mass transfer processes.
     
    Constructed from heat-resistant, corrosion-resistant plastics (PE, PP, RPP, PVC, CPVC, PVDF), it performs stably in media temperatures ranging from 60°C to 150°C. Compared to Pall Rings, this packing offers lower flow resistance, larger flux, and higher overall efficiency; it also features excellent durability and easy loading/unloading for practical industrial use.
     
    Widely applied in absorption towers, distillation systems, pressure reduction equipment, and desulfurization setups, it suits chemical processing, petroleum refining, and environmental protection industries—including the isolation of substances like ethylbenzene and toluene.
